π Types of Scholarships at the University of Arizona
UA offers several categories of scholarships:
1. Merit-Based Scholarships
Awarded to students with high GPAs, standardized test scores, or strong academic performance.
- Wildcat Excellence Award β Up to $12,000 per year for outstanding undergraduates.
- Arizona Distinction Award β For high-achieving in-state students.
2. International Student Scholarships
Designed specifically for students outside the U.S.
- Arizona International Tuition Award β Up to $20,000 per year for international undergraduates.
- Global Wildcat Award β Partial tuition reductions based on academic merit.
3. Graduate Scholarships & Assistantships
Graduate students can apply for:
- Graduate College Fellowships
- Research Assistantships (RA)
- Teaching Assistantships (TA)
These often cover tuition and provide stipends.
4. Need-Based Aid
Available to U.S. citizens and permanent residents through FAFSA (Free Application for Federal Student Aid).
π Eligibility Requirements
- Undergraduate Scholarships: High GPA (usually 3.0+), strong transcripts, and in some cases, SAT/ACT scores.
- International Scholarships: Admission to a degree program + English proficiency test scores (TOEFL, IELTS, or Duolingo).
- Graduate Scholarships: Strong academic record, research experience, and program-specific requirements.
π How to Apply
- Apply for Admission β Submit your application to the University of Arizona.
- Automatic Consideration β Many scholarships (like Wildcat Excellence) are automatically awarded based on GPA/test scores.
- Complete Scholarship Applications β Some require separate applications via the UA Scholarship Universe portal.
- Submit Required Documents β Transcripts, essays, recommendation letters (if applicable).
- Meet Deadlines β Apply before March 1, 2025 (priority deadline for most awards).
